
The Risks of Being a Loan Guarantor and Why You Need a Solicitor’s Certificate
Signing a loan as a guarantor is a significant financial responsibility that carries serious risks. If the borrower defaults, you may be required to step in and cover the debt, potentially affecting your credit rating and putting your assets at risk. It’s crucial to fully understand the loan terms and your obligations before agreeing to sign. A solicitor's certificate ensures you are fully informed of the risks, helping you make a sound decision. Before agreeing to be a guarantor, seek legal advice to protect your financial future.
